Volkswagen Golf Service & Repair Manual: Introduction
| This repair manual is intended to provide technicians and
fitters with the basic knowledge required for performing trained
work on these systems. |
Note
| Successful completion of a training course such as AB160 or
ST160 Air conditioning systems including "technical information"
is required. |
| This repair manual is a part of the training material. |
| It should also be available to the responsible supervisory
authorities upon request. |
Caution
| Non-authorised tools or materials (e.g. leak
inhibitor additive) may cause damage or adversely
influence the system. |
| Only tools and materials approved by the
manufacturer may be used. |
| The use of non-approved tools or materials will
render the warranty void. |

Removing and installing turn signal switch -E2-, Valeo
Note
The turn signal switch -E2-, cruise control system switch
-E45- and intermittent wiper switch -E22- are combined to form
the steering column combination switch -E595-.
These switches cannot be separated.
